Transaction e150a19eabeae438064ce393034ffdcc10e05666c23b1d7c6d0bd091018aee35
1 Input
1 Output
-
e150a19eabeae438064ce393034ffdcc10e05666c23b1d7c6d0bd091018aee35:0
- value
- 7543
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f318592788b9b6bf2c098647650618e53607d38
- address
- bc1qhucctync3wdkhukqnpj8v5rp3efkqlfcc8qxlf